Is Methamphetamine Allowed in Down Under? A Detailed Explanation
Absolutely certainly, methamphetamine, frequently referred to "ice," "copyright," or "tina," is strictly illegal in Australia. Possessing, using, manufacturing, or selling this prohibited substance carries substantial penalties, including imprisonment prison terms and hefty monetary fines. There are no exceptions or legal avenues for obtaining methamphetamine; any attempt to do so is a criminal offense under both state and territory law. Police actively target the production and distribution of methamphetamine to protect public well-being and reduce the devastating consequences of its use.
